One of my favorite things to find on my road trips are old school houses. Many of them are actually on people's property, but I came across this little one a couple weekends ago
[IMG] IMG_1014 by , on Flickr[/IMG]
Pretty cool in and of itself, but the door was open. So in I went.
[IMG] clasroom4 by , on Flickr[/IMG]
There was so much cool stuff in this place, but it was covered in pigeon crap, so I didn't want to stay in there too long. The weird thing was that there wasn't a single pigeon on the main floor. But there were stairs to the basement and I could hear TONS of the birds down there cooing and flying around. I don't know why they were down there instead of upstairs, but I didn't go down to find out. It was a bit creepy.
There was stuff strewn about and other little signs. Names on the chalkboard, and Xmas decorations left.
xmas by , on Flickr
But the best thing was an old piano tucked away in the corner. Tough to get a good shot because of the lighting (and again my desire to get out of this bird-crap covered place) but did the best I could.
